Amish Buggy Accident

The Otter Tail County Sheriff’s Office says, one woman has severe injuries after a minivan rear ended her Amish buggy. Just before 6 pm on Monday  Oct. 14, deputies and New York Milles Fire/Rescue responded to the crash. The driver of the minivan, 85-year-old Allyn Jokela, rear ended the buggy. Officials say, they were treated for non-life-threatening injuries and was released at the scene. The driver of the buggy, 40-year-old Mabel Stauffer, had serious injuries and was taken to a local hospital for further evaluation. Both drivers are said to be the lone occupants in the vehicles. Alcohol is not believed to be a factor. The crash is under investigation.
